Peña de las Campanas
Peña de las Campanas is a peak in Robledo de Corpes, Guadalajara, Castile-La Mancha and has an elevation of 1,221 metres. Peña de las Campanas is situated nearby to the locality Cuesta de Matacollados, as well as near Horcajo de Matacollados.Places in the Area
Nearby places include La Bodera and Hiendelaencina.

Hiendelaencina is a municipality located in the province of Guadalajara,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ality had a population of 131 inhabitants.
